About this listen

The premier podcast for ski mountaineering competition and participation. Explore the high-altitude, high-stakes world of ski mountaineering as elite athletes prepare for Olympic competition and beyond. From the World Cup podium to the local skintrack, SKIMO GOLD is THE podcast for smooth-gliding, quick-transitioning, lung-burning, kick-turning beta on training, racing, gear, fueling, mindset, and–most importantly–FUN! Join hosts Travis Macy and Cam Smith regularly for novel conversations with the world’s best athletes, coaches, organizers, and skimo aficionados.   • 18. Anna Gibson & Cam Smith: Reflecting on Trail Running Season and Looking Ahead to Skimo
    Nov 3 2025

    In this episode of SkiMo Gold, Travis and Cam are joined by elite trail runner Anna Gibson to recap their 2025 trail season and look ahead to the upcoming SkiMo winter. They reflect on the highs and lows of racing in Europe, managing injuries, and staying mentally resilient through setbacks and surprises.

    Anna opens up about navigating a tough year with humor and perspective, while Cam shares what it’s like to pivot goals mid-season and return to his SkiMo roots. Together, they talk about training adaptations, lessons learned, and why community matters just as much as competition.

  • 17. Nicolo Conclini: Italian Star on Milano Cortina 2026 and Life in Bormio
    Oct 13 2025

    In this episode of SkiMo Gold, Cam Smith and Travis Macy chat with Italy’s Nicolo Conclini, a rising star on the international circuit and a strong contender for the Milano Cortina 2026 Olympic Games. Hailing from the iconic ski town of Bormio, Nicolo shares what it’s like to grow up in a place where mountains and racing are a way of life.

    They dig into his breakout season, his approach to training and recovery, and the passion that fuels his Olympic dreams. From World Cup courses to the alpine culture of northern Italy, this is a conversation full of insight, humility, and genuine love for the sport.

  • 16. Across the Alps and Generations: Michael Silitch on Mentorship, Mindset, and the Heart of Skimo
    Sep 22 2025

    In this episode of Skimo Gold, Cam Smith and Travis Macy sit down with Michael Silitch, a trailblazer in American ski mountaineering whose roots run deep in the Alps and the global Skimo community. Michael shares his decades-spanning journey from racing in Chamonix to mentoring young athletes and what it means to pass the torch while staying in the game himself.

    Michael reflects on the evolution of the sport, the value of long-term athletic development, and why mindset matters as much as VO2 max. Whether you’re chasing podiums or finding joy in the process, this one’s packed with timeless insight from a true ambassador of Skimo.
